Loparex is the world's leading developer and producer of specialty paper and film release liners. We partner with customers around the globe and enable sustainable performance through our in-depth material science expertise and industry-leading technology portfolio. The company is headquartered in Cary, North Carolina, U.S.A. and has three manufacturing sites in North America (Hammond, WI; Iowa City; IA; Malvern, PA), two manufacturing sites in Europe (Apeldoorn, The Netherlands; Forchheim, Germany), one manufacturing site in India (Silvassa) and one manufacturing site in China (Guangzhou).
